The NXP S9S12GA64F0MLF is a high-performance, 16-bit microcontroller designed for automotive and industrial applications. This powerful MCU is part of the HCS12 family and is built upon the proven S12 core, offering a perfect blend of computational power, enhanced features, and robustness to meet the rigorous demands of advanced embedded systems.
Key Features
- Core: The S9S12GA64F0MLF features a 16-bit HCS12 CPU that provides a maximum bus speed of 25MHz, delivering efficient processing capabilities for complex algorithms and control tasks.
- Memory: It comes equipped with 64KB of flash memory and 4KB of RAM, ensuring ample space for application code and data storage.
- Digital I/O: This MCU includes 59 digital I/O pins, offering versatile interfacing options with sensors, actuators, and other peripherals.
- Timers: Multiple timing systems, including an 8-channel, 16-bit timer, 8-channel PWM, and a 2-channel, 16-bit Real-Time Interrupt timer, provide precise timing and control for a wide range of applications.
- Analog-to-Digital Converter: An integrated 10-bit ADC with up to 16 channels allows for accurate analog signal measurement and conversion.
- Communication Interfaces: The MCU supports various communication protocols such as SCI (UART), SPI, and I2C, facilitating easy data exchange and peripheral connectivity.
- Package: The device comes in an 80-QFP (Quad Flat Package) that is suitable for space-constrained applications while offering adequate pin access for interfacing.
- Temperature Range: It operates within an extended temperature range of -40°C to 105°C, making it ideal for harsh operating environments.
- Supply Voltage: The S9S12GA64F0MLF operates at a supply voltage of 3.13V to 5.5V, providing flexibility in power design and compatibility with a variety of systems.
